The Role
The Logistics Coordinator manages customer returns by processing shipments, ensuring documentation accuracy, collaborating cross-functionally, and providing general support to the logistics team.

Actigraph is seeking a Logistics Coordinator to supports the Logistics Manager with reverse logistics and inbound material flow regarding all customer returns. The primary responsibility of this role is to receive, verify, process, and schedule incoming return shipments while ensuring accuracy, timely communication, and proper documentation. This position works closely with Inventory, Quality, Sales, and Project Management to resolve discrepancies and maintain smooth returns processing. The coordinator also provides general support to the broader logistics team as needed to meet departmental and operational goals.

What We Do

ActiGraph is pioneering the digital transformation of clinical research. We provide end-to-end digital health technology (DHT) solutions by integrating and operationalizing the best wearables, software, and algorithms to generate reliable evidence and get the right treatments to the right patients, faster. ActiGraph’s medical-grade wearable technology platform has been used to capture real-world, continuous digital measures of sleep, activity, and mobility for nearly 250 industry-sponsored clinical trials and thousands of academic research and public health studies. Appearing in over 23,000 published scientific papers to date, ActiGraph is the most experienced and trusted wearable technology partner in the industry.
